Getting offer is not end, it's only start of team matching. Google is trying to place people into jobs they actually like doing. Multiple reasons for this - in order for you to be self-motivated and let you become an expert in systems you are working with. While moves are allowed (manager can not block you), just by following this longer process teams are more stable.
If you have competing offers, tell the recruiter deadlines. Generally it takes anywhere between few days to couple fo weeks. Your rexruiter should be keeping you updated on the status.
